View Single Post
Old 07-11-2007, 05:23 PM   #1
sln333's Avatar
Join Date: Jun 2007
Location: Massachusetts
Posts: 275
Send a message via Yahoo to sln333

Gamertag: sln333
E3 Halo Wars Trailer

Here's the E3 trailer for the Halo Wars game. It's got some gameplay and I am really looking forward to this game. Enjoy!
Who Watches the Watchmen
sln333 is offline   Reply With Quote